Claude Lorieux
Claude Lorieux (born the December 17th 1936 with Paris and deceased the April 25th 2005 with Guérande of a cancer of the spinal-cord), was a journalist French. Former collaborator of the Barber and large specialist in the the Middle East.
He lived in Brittany and furrowed the countries of the Middle-East for the Figaro daily newspaper for which he was collaborator since 1978 and large specialist in the Middle East. Author of a work entitled: Christians of the East out of ground of Islam.
Born on December 17th, 1936 in Paris, he worked at the France Presse Agency (AFP) where he had entered in 1962. Correspondent in Rome and New York, it had covered the war of Vietnam in 1967-68. He had again set out again as correspondent of AFP in Brussels then in London. He was married and father of two children,
